In a methodical approach, the text covers various aspects of wave propagation, from basic theory to complex applications in diverse fields such as acoustics, electromagnetics, and fluid dynamics. The detailed explanations are complemented by practical examples, making the concepts more accessible to readers with varying levels of expertise.
Engquist and Kriegsmann emphasize the importance of numerical methods and their applications in real-world scenarios. Through this comprehensive resource, readers are invited to deepen their understanding and application of computational techniques, empowering them to tackle complex wave propagation challenges in both research and industry settings.
